  • Couple of pointers from me, as I did experience noise early on:

    • Use your neck pickup, ideally a single coil
    • Try a different base profile - even though Cab is off, other settings can affect it. Rather than wade through and find the issue, another profile strangely made a difference
    • I also had my profiles very high in volume, meaning I also had to turn up the volume significantly on the acoustic sim which added a lot of noise. I re-levelled my profiles and that helped significantly

    I didn't find a big difference in the update but make sure you are running the latest version.
